Good luck. I hear it's a great place to live - not as lively as some of the other cities, but a great 'lifestyle' choice! For what it's worth, it is somewhere that would be on my radar if anything cropped up that prompted me to move from Auckland.

Generally speaking, you should be able to buy a reasonable house in Australia for the price of a flat in England. Obviously, not if you want to live in the ultimate yuppieville centre of town type address; but generally you get a lot more bang for your buck down under. Cost of living is generally good.
